Full Description

Desired residence locations: Philadelphia; PA, Charlotte; NC, Atlanta; GA, Chicago; IL, Dallas, TX; Phoenix, AZ; Seattle, WA; Bentonville, AK SUMMARY: Establishes and manages a sales pipeline that will achieve revenue and growth targets established by the Company. Developing strategies, analyzing market trends, and building client relationships will be key to this role. Responsibilities include hitting sales targets, managing the sales pipeline, following sales processes, and collaborating with other departments like Operations, Marketing and Finance to drive customer satisfaction and revenue. D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: • Establishes and maintains a pipeline of prospective customers. • Develops and implements a sales action plan with objectives and strategies consistent with iGPS’ goals to increase revenue and acquire new accounts. • Manages and cultivates relationships with clients to enhance loyalty and identify new business opportunities. • Develops customer relations including but not limited to sales, research, qualifying and developing opportunities. • Regularly interacts with appropriate contacts and executives of identified and prospective clients. • Analyzes anticipated client needs and promotes company services to fill such requirements. • Manages the preparation and implementation of sales and business development plans, sales forecasts and strategies. • Maintains accuracy and currency of sales data within iGPS CRM. • Formulates the overall objectives and strategy to develop a high-value relationship within all targeted areas of the accounts. • Understands prospective client’s culture, product portfolio, competitive position, financial state, investment plan, organization structure and key decision makers. • Functions as liaison between client companies and operations staff. • Develops and maintains collaborative relationships with all areas/departments within iGPS organization. Ensures a smooth transition to the Account Management team. • Attends conventions, conferences, and trade shows as needed; prepares post-event reports and analysis. • Performs other related duties as assigned by management. QUALIFICATIONS: • Bachelor’s degree (B.A.) or equivalent. • Four to six years sales or procurement experience ideally in the grocery or CPG industry. • Ability to create sales results in a complex sales environment. • Supply Chain – warehousing, manufacturing, distribution, or logistics experience preferred. •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. • Proven business acumen skills. • Well-developed negotiation, project and account management skills. • Demonstrated ability to make successful presentations to individuals and/or groups at all levels of an organization. • Ability to work independently and as a member of various teams and committees • Commitment to excellence and high standards. • Ability to work with all levels of management. • Strong organizational, problem-solving, and analytical skills. • Good judgment with the ability to make timely and sound decisions. • Creative, flexible, and innovative team player. • Excellent consultative sales skills. • Proven ability to handle multiple projects and meet deadlines • Strong interpersonal skills. • Versatility, flexibility, and a willingness to work within constantly changing priorities with enthusiasm. • Proficient on PowerPoint, Excel, Word and CRM platform(s) COMPETENCIES: • Problem Solving--Identifies and resolves problems in a timely manner; Gathers and analyzes information skillfully; Develops alternative solutions; Works well in group problem solving situations; Uses reason even when dealing with emotional topics. • Customer Management Skills--Manages difficult or emotional customer situations; Responds promptly to customer needs; Solicits customer feedback to improve service; Responds to requests for service and assistance; Meets commitments. • Interpersonal Skills--Focuses on solving conflict, not blaming; Maintains confidentiality; Listens to others without interrupting; Keeps emotions under control; Remains open to others' ideas and tries new things. • Oral Communication--Speaks clearly and persuasively in positive or negative situations; Listens and gets clarification; Responds well to questions; Demonstrates group presentation skills; Participates in meetings. • Written Communication--Writes clearly and informatively; Edits work for spelling and grammar; Varies writing style to meet needs; Presents numerical data effectively; Able to read and interpret written information. • Teamwork--Balances team and individual responsibilities; Exhibits objectivity and openness to others' views; Gives and welcomes feedback; Contributes to building a positive team spirit; Puts success of team above own interests; Able to build morale and group commitments to goals and objectives; Supports everyone's efforts to succeed. • Diversity--Shows respect and sensitivity for cultural differences; Educates others on the value of diversity; Promotes a harassment-free environment; Builds a diverse workforce. • Ethics--Treats people with respect; Keeps commitments; Inspires the trust of others; Works with integrity and ethically; Upholds organizational values. • Strategic Thinking--Develops strategies to achieve organizational goals; Understands organization's strengths & weaknesses; Analyzes market and competition; Identifies external threats and opportunities; Adapts strategy to changing conditions. • Planning/Organizing-Prioritizes and plans work activities; Uses time efficiently; Plans for additional resources; Sets goals and objectives; Organizes or schedules other people and their tasks; Develops realistic action plans. • Professionalism--Approaches others in a tactful manner; Reacts well under pressure; Treats others with respect and consideration regardless of their status or position; Accepts responsibility for own actions; Follows through on commitments. Physical Demands & Work Environment Sitting: Frequently or constantly required to sit for long periods, especially when working on a computer or traveling by car/plane. Standing/Walking: Occasionally or frequently required to stand and walk, which can include moving about inside the office to access files and machinery, or extended walking through airports or large facilities. Travel: Requires significant travel (up to 50% per month), which involves sitting in vehicles for long periods and potentially navigating various locations
